Hello all - Introducing myself to the forum. I purchased a 2014 FType S v6 over in the summer and after finding and reading informative posts here I joined hoping to both learn and share what I find about this car. I come from a 2012 Mustang GT w/6spd, before that a 2007 G35 6mt sedan. The thing that sold me was that the Jag handled like on rails as compared to the Mustang. And what a much more beautiful car and a hell of a lot more fun to drive even without a stick. In fact I don't miss the stick at all, which I thought would be a big tradeoff.
I plan to do most if not all work on my Jag myself, as she will be riding out the winter in my garage as the warranty expires. Forgive me if I ask stupid or asked-and-answered questions. Hopefully I can also post lessons learned about my adventures keeping her on the road.
In summary - Pros: Handling, nice car. Cons: wife decided she had to have a mini cooper convertible right afterwards.
